The Chief Executive Officer of Pelican Valley Nigeria Limited, Ambassador (Dr) Babatunde Adeyemo, has celebrated the Chairperson of the Nigerians in Diaspora Commission (NiDCOM), Hon. Abike Dabiri-Erewa, on her birthday, applauding her for fostering stronger ties between Nigerians at home and abroad.
Adeyemo, in a congratulatory statement issued on Friday, described Dabiri-Erewa as a “veritable and dependable bridge between Nigerians at home and Nigerians in the diaspora,” noting that her leadership at NiDCOM has helped harness the enormous potential and contributions of Nigerians living abroad to national development.
The real estate mogul, whose firm is behind Pelican Valley Estate Laderin, Abeokuta described as “where unusual home happens” commended Dabiri-Erewa for championing policies and initiatives that have encouraged diaspora remittances and investments into the Nigerian economy.
